A SERVICE OF

logo

AUDIT LOG RECORD FORMAT
Audit log data
Copying an Audit Log with the Log Save function will create a
uniquely named *.ALG file that contains only the log data for that
report. This is the file name that will be associated with the user
report name in the Master Audit Directory file.
This file contains several types of records, which share a common
set of keys. One of these keys is a Record Type field which
specifies the structure of the remaining data in the record. When
accessing these records, ensure that your buffer is at least as
large as the longest possible record, the Log Header, which is
361 bytes long. Once the record is read you can use the
common key structure (section "a" of each record type) to
access the Record Type field. The value of this field indicates
which record structure to use in accessing the data in the
remainder of the record.
Log header record
Contains report summary and status information for a single
report.
Table A-2. Log header record
Description
Type Length Comments
Key fields Delivery time double word 4 see notes
Sequence number word 2 sequence number of page
Report number word 2 generated by ESS
Entry number word 2 entry number in master directory
Record type word 2 value is 1
Error flags word 2 see notes
Tie break word 2 same second chronological order
Null key word 2 null key segment for Btrieve
Data Job number word 2 assigned by ESS
Report name character 20
User job number character 7
User department # character 32
Reserved character 12 not used
Sheets fed word array 2x8 number of sheets fed by source
Reserved word array 2x8
Sheets purged word array 2x8 number of sheets purged by source
Reserved word array 2x8
Sheets delivered word array 2x8 number of sheets delivered by source
Reserved word array 2x8
XEROX 4635 LPS PRODUCT REFERENCE A-3